Flare Size and Style

Choosing the right flare size and style can make your jeans look great. It’s like finding the perfect shoes that fit just right. Flares come in different shapes—from small bell bottoms to big, wide legs. If you want a vintage, old-school vibe, go for wider flares. For a modern, sleek look, pick a softer, subtler flare.

Your body shape matters too. Wider flares look good on pear-shaped bodies. If you have an hourglass figure, a small flare works well. Also, think about your height. Longer flares can make your legs look longer. But if they are too wide, they might seem too big for you.

Style is important too. Bootcut jeans have a small flare and are great for casual days. Trumpet flares are bold and make a statement.

Pick your flare size carefully. The right style can make your jeans look even better and suit your personal style.

Rise and Inseam Options

Choosing the right flare jeans depends a lot on the rise and inseam. The rise is how high the waistband sits on your waist. The inseam is the length of the leg from the crotch to the bottom.

A higher rise, around 9.5 inches or more, covers your tummy and makes your legs look longer. That’s a great look!

The inseam matters too. If you are petite, pick a shorter inseam. It will make the flare start right at your ankle. If you are tall, a longer inseam keeps your jeans looking balanced.

Picking the right rise and inseam helps your jeans fit well. They will sit just right and match your body perfectly.

Care and Maintenance

Taking care of your flare jeans is simple. It’s not just about avoiding stains or tears. It’s about keeping the fit, color, and look you love. No one wants jeans that fade in a few washes or lose their shape fast!

Always follow the care instructions on the tag. Most jeans do best with cold water and low heat when drying. Turning your jeans inside out before washing helps keep the color bright. Stay away from bleach and strong chemicals. They can damage the fabric and ruin your jeans.

For extra care, wash your jeans by hand or put them on a gentle cycle. This keeps the fabric in good shape. Check your jeans regularly. If you see loose threads or missing rivets, fix them right away. Taking care of small issues now can help your jeans last longer and stay looking great.

What Footwear Complements Flare Bootcut Jeans?

You should pair flare bootcut jeans with heels or wedges to heighten your silhouette, or opt for ankle boots for a casual look. Avoid bulky shoes that can overwhelm the balance and flow of your flare jeans.

How Should Flare Jeans Be Cared for to Maintain Shape?

You should wash flare jeans in cold water and avoid high heat during drying to maintain their shape. Turn them inside out, use gentle cycles, and hang or lay flat to prevent stretching and preserve their flattering silhouette.
